This phonics activity set helps children build and spell words using illustrated cards and letter tiles. Kids can look at the picture on the card, then use the tiles to spell sight words and CVC words like "cat" and "bus." Designed for ages 4+, it supports letter recognition, letter sounds, spelling, and phonemic awareness.
The set includes a spelling board with a self-checking feature, 50 double-sided word cards, and 40 letter and phoneme tiles. Color-coded tiles distinguish vowels, consonants, vowel teams, and digraphs to reinforce phonics learning. After spelling a word, children can slide the bar to see the tiles drop down the chute.

Things to Keep in MindA common concern is that the design hinders truly independent play, as the manual card insertion often exposes the word to the child before they attempt to spell it. Some users also mention practical issues such as letters occasionally getting stuck and the absence of a dedicated storage solution for the components, which can lead to missing pieces. Why You'll Like ItUsers frequently note that the toy effectively makes learning sight words and spelling an engaging and enjoyable activity for young children, often without them realizing it's an educational task. Its interactive, hands-on approach, supported by durable, color-coded cards and a self-checking feature, is highlighted as particularly helpful for reinforcing letter recognition, vowels, and consonants.
